Ingredients You’ll Need for a Healthy Boost

Gather these ingredients to create your nourishing dish:

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il (divided)
  • 1 pound ground turkey
  • 1 small sweet onion (finely diced)
  • 1 cup shredded carrots
  • 3 garlic cloves (finely minced)
  • 1 teaspoon finely minced fresh ginger
  • ¼ cup chicken broth
  • 1 small head cabbage (about 8 cups shredded; see note)
  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ce or tamari
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• ¾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on toasted sesame oil
  • Cooked white rice (optional)
  • Green onions (green parts only, thinly sliced)
  • Toasted sesame seeds
  • Sriracha Mayo (optional)

Note:

For a quicker prep, you can buy pre-shredded cabbage and carrots. This makes things even simpler on busy days!

Step-by-Step Directions

Now, let’s break it down into easy steps to follow:

Heat the Oil

Start by heating 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. This creates a base for browning the meat and adding flavor.

Cook the Turkey

Add the ground turkey and cook until it’s nearly done, about 5–6 minutes. Break it apart with a spoon as it cooks so it browns evenly.

Sauté the Onion

Push the turkey to one side of the pan. Add the remaining tablespoon of oil and the diced onion. Stir and cook for 3–4 minutes until softened and fragrant.

Add Carrots, Garlic & Ginger

Toss in the shredded carrots, minced garlic, and ginger. Stir everything together and cook for 2 more minutes to bring out the flavors.

Deglaze with Broth

Pour in the chicken broth and scrape the bottom of the skillet to release any browned bits. This adds rich flavor to the dish.

Cook the Cabbage Mix

Add the shredded cabbage, soy sauce or tamari, rice vinegar, salt, and black pepper. Stir well, cover, and cook on medium-low for 12–15 minutes, until the cabbage is tender.

Finish with Sesame Oil

Remove the skillet from the heat and drizzle in the sesame oil. Stir to coat everything and give the dish a nutty aroma.

Serve & Enjoy

Spoon the egg roll mixture over cooked white rice, if desired. Garnish with sliced green onions, toasted sesame seeds, and a drizzle of sriracha mayo for extra flavor.

Keeping It Fresh for Later

If you want to save some for later, that’s easy to do.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h for 3-4 days. When you’re ready, simply reheat it in the microwave or on the stovetop. This way, you’ll reduce food waste while enjoying your meal again.

Smart Swaps and Variations

Eating well doesn’t have to be complicated. Here are a few swaps and variations you can try to fit your lifestyle:

  • Gluten-Free: Use tamari instead of soy sauce to keep it gluten-free.
  • Dairy-Free: This recipe is naturally dairy-free, so you can enjoy it without worry.
  • Vegetarian Option: You can substitute the ground turkey with tofu or tempeh for a plant-based version.
  • Extra Veggies: Feel free to add any other veggies you have on hand, like bell peppers, snap peas, or mushrooms.

FAQs About Egg Roll in a Bowl Recipe

Can I make this ahead of time?

Yes! This recipe is meal-prep friendly. Cook it, cool it, and store in the fridge for 3–4 days. Reheat on the stovetop for best texture, or microwave if you’re short on time.

What if I don’t have ground turkey?

No problem swap in ground chicken, pork, or even beef. Want a plant-based twist? Crumbled tofu or tempeh works great, and still soaks up all that garlicky, gingery flavor.

How do I reheat leftovers without drying them out?

Add a splash of chicken broth or water to the skillet while reheating. It freshens up the cabbage and keeps the turkey juicy.

Can I freeze Egg Roll in a Bowl?

You can, but the cabbage softens a lot after thawing. If you do freeze it, just expect a softer texture. I prefer keeping it in the fridge and finishing it within a few days.
